Exploring Spark Jobs in India

The demand for professionals with expertise in Spark is on the rise in India. Spark, an open-source distributed computing system, is widely used for big data processing and analytics. Job seekers in India looking to explore opportunities in Spark can find a variety of roles in different industries.

Top Hiring Locations in India

  1. Bangalore
  2. Pune
  3. Hyderabad
  4. Chennai
  5. Mumbai

These cities have a high concentration of tech companies and startups actively hiring for Spark roles.

Average Salary Range

The average salary range for Spark professionals in India varies based on experience level: - Entry-level: INR 4-6 lakhs per annum - Mid-level: INR 8-12 lakhs per annum - Experienced: INR 15-25 lakhs per annum

Salaries may vary based on the company, location, and specific job requirements.

Career Path

In the field of Spark, a typical career progression may look like: - Junior Developer - Senior Developer - Tech Lead - Architect

Advancing in this career path often requires gaining experience, acquiring additional skills, and taking on more responsibilities.

Related Skills

Apart from proficiency in Spark, professionals in this field are often expected to have knowledge or experience in: - Hadoop - Java or Scala programming - Data processing and analytics - SQL databases

Having a combination of these skills can make a candidate more competitive in the job market.
